Job summary

A specialist neurodevelopmental service is seeking Remote ADHD Nurse Prescribers to diagnose and treat ADHD, manage medication, and collaborate with healthcare teams. The role requires monthly clinic attendance in Canterbury or Basingstoke. Ideal candidates are qualified Mental Health Nurses with expertise in ADHD and excellent communication skills. Offers a supportive working environment with comprehensive benefits and flexible hours.
